A family inheritance dispute involving media personality Tucker Carlson has escalated into a public controversy after his stepsister, Dr. Roberta “Bo” Hunt, spoke out over claims tied to the Swanson family fortune.
The disagreement centers on Hunt’s claim that she shares a family connection with Carlson and that he may be seeking a share of inheritance linked to the Swanson legacy. Carlson has reportedly denied recognizing her as a family member, a position Hunt strongly disputes.
According to Hunt, the conflict is not only about money but also about recognition of family ties. She has pointed to past photographs and shared history as evidence of their relationship.
Carlson has not issued a detailed public statement on the matter. However, according to the Daily Mail report published on April 23, 2026, he is said to have dismissed claims of any meaningful connection.
“I don’t know her,” Carlson is quoted as saying in reference to Hunt, according to the report.
Hunt, however, challenges that position. “There is a clear family history that cannot be ignored,” she said, responding to claims that she has no recognized relationship with him.
The Swanson family fortune, linked to the frozen food brand that popularized TV dinners in the United States, has long been managed through structured trusts that determine how wealth is distributed among heirs.

Trust Claims and Conflicting Accounts
At the center of the disagreement is how the family trust is structured and who is legally entitled to benefit from it.
Hunt claims the trust excludes Carlson from inheritance rights connected to her branch of the family. She argues that the original arrangement was designed to benefit specific descendants tied directly to the Swanson lineage.
Carlson’s side has not publicly addressed the details of the trust. There is no confirmed legal filing disclosed in connection with the dispute at this stage.
The disagreement has played out largely through media reporting and public statements rather than court proceedings. Neither party has confirmed whether legal action is underway.
The issue has drawn attention due to the conflicting accounts of family history. While Hunt insists there is documented evidence of their connection, Carlson’s reported position denies any meaningful relationship.
The Swanson name remains associated with one of the most recognizable frozen food brands in American retail history. Family trusts tied to such estates are often complex and can lead to disputes when interpretations differ among relatives.
